So far there is very little or none available in Singapore for colour sheets paper. I know they have it in Australia when I was there for my studies. Yes they only have it in rolls and they have different length and sizes. The price is range form 70-150 bucks a roll. This is quite sensitive material as you need a very big changing bag or a total darkness room to cut your paper.

How do you print on colour paper? It has to be in total darkness unless of course you have a RA-4 paper developing machine......Chemicals for colour paper are quite hazardous to the enviroment.

It is quite dangerous using a changing bag to cut your roll of paper. What happend if you cut the bag? your whole roll of paper will be gone. On top of that, how are you goin to put the whole roll of paper without getting it expose? The best is to go a place with a total lightproof room and cut the whole roll. Better than using a changing bag.
